For the listed solutions, compare the osmotic pressure, boiling point, freezing point, and vapor pressure at 50. °C. Part 1 of 4 Which solution has the highest osmotic pressure? Select the single best answer. O 0.100 m NaNO3 O 0.100 m glucose O 0.100 m CaCl₂ Part 2 of 4 Which solution has the highest boiling point? Select the single best answer. O 0.100 m NaNO3 O 0.100 m glucose 0 0.100 m CaCl₂ Part 3 of 4 Which solution has the highest freezing point? Select the single best answer. O 0.100 m NaNO3 O 0.100 m glucose O 0.100 m CaCl₂ Part 4 of 4 x Which solution has the highest vapor pressure at 50. °C? Select the single best answer. O 0.100 m NaNO3 O 0.100 m glucose 0.100 m CaCl₂ X
